Seneca County Sheriff Jack Stenberg reports Deputies responded to a one-car personal injury motor vehicle accident on Yost Road in the Town of Fayette. A vehicle being operated by Imelda M. Saito, 43, of 116 East Main Street in Waterloo, was northbound on Yost Road when she suddenly swerved to avoid an animal in the roadway. Saito’s vehicle left the roadway striking the ditch. Saito suffered a minor head laceration and was transported to Geneva General Hospital by North Seneca Ambulance. The Waterloo Fire Department also assisted at the scene. The vehicle suffered extensive damage and was towed from the scene.
